What is Deep Vein Thrombosis?Deep Vein Thrombosis, or DVT, is a blood clot that forms deep within your body. DVT is a serious conditionthat can occur when you are not moving around a lot, for example, when you are in the hospital. To understandhow a blood clot can form and affect you, let’s take a look at the blood vessels deep within your body.When you are healthy, blood flows through your blood vessels delivering oxygen and nutrients to all parts ofyour body.But during periods of inactivity, or with reduced blood circulation, blood flow can slow down and blood cancollect in the veins deep within your body, thicken, and clump together to form a clot.This clot can then block the normal blood flow in your vessels, especially in the lower legs, thighs and hips. Itusually happens in one leg at a time, not both, and causes pain, swelling, redness, warmth, and tenderness, inthat leg.Sometimes, a clot may break away and travel through your blood vessels.Called an ‘embolus’, this moving clot can travel to the heart or lungs and cause severe complications includingpulmonary embolism which can lead to difficulty breathing or even death.Deep Vein Thrombosis can occur in anyone. As you recover from surgery or illness in the hospital, you maynot be active. When you are inactive, your blood does not circulate as well as it needs to and may more easilyform a blood clot.The medications used to put you to sleep during surgery can also increase your risk of blood clots. Or you mayhave poor circulation from other health problems which can reduce your blood flow and cause a clot to form.Whatever the reason, when you are in the hospital you may be at a greater risk for Deep Vein Thrombosis andthe complications can be serious.Luckily, many of the things you can do to help your recovery can also help you prevent DVT and the seriouscomplications that can come with it. Work with your healthcare provider to create a plan to reduce your risk ofDVT.This program is for informational purposes only.
